  • Importance Of Fire Alarm System Heat Detectors

    In the world of fire protection and prevention, fire alarm systems play a crucial role in notifying building occupants of potential fire hazards. One integral component of these systems is the heat detector, which detects changes in temperature and triggers an alarm if a certain threshold is reached. In this article, we will explore the importance of fire alarm system heat detectors and how they contribute to overall building safety.

    Fire alarm systems are designed to alert occupants of a building when there is a potential fire threat. They are typically comprised of multiple components, including smoke detectors, heat detectors, sprinklers, and alarms. Each of these components plays a specific role in ensuring the safety of those inside the building.

    Heat detectors are a key component of fire alarm systems because they are able to detect changes in temperature that indicate the presence of a fire. Unlike smoke detectors, which rely on the presence of smoke particles to trigger an alarm, heat detectors respond to increases in temperature. This makes them ideal for use in areas where smoke detection may not be as effective, such as kitchens or areas with high levels of dust or fumes.

    There are two main types of heat detectors used in fire alarm systems: fixed temperature detectors and rate-of-rise detectors. Fixed temperature detectors are designed to trigger an alarm when a specific temperature threshold is reached. These detectors are best suited for areas where a fire is likely to generate a significant amount of heat in a short period of time, such as storage rooms or boiler rooms.

    Rate-of-rise detectors, on the other hand, are designed to detect rapid increases in temperature over a short period of time. These detectors are ideal for use in areas where fires are more likely to spread quickly, such as corridors or stairwells. By detecting changes in temperature before smoke is present, rate-of-rise detectors can provide early warning of a fire and help to minimize damage and injuries.

    In addition to providing early warning of a fire, heat detectors can also help to reduce false alarms. Smoke detectors are prone to false alarms caused by cooking fumes, steam, or dust particles, which can be a nuisance to building occupants and a drain on emergency resources. Heat detectors are less sensitive to these types of contaminants, making them a more reliable option in areas where false alarms are a concern.

    Another benefit of heat detectors is their ability to function in a wider range of environmental conditions. Smoke detectors can be affected by high humidity or extreme temperatures, which can reduce their effectiveness. Heat detectors, on the other hand, are less vulnerable to these environmental factors and can provide reliable fire detection in a variety of conditions.

  • The Power Of High Pressure Homogenizers

    In the world of food and beverage processing, high pressure homogenizers play a crucial role in achieving the desired consistency, texture, and quality of the final product. These powerful machines utilize high pressure to reduce particle size and create a smooth and uniform mixture, making them an essential tool in various industries such as dairy, p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, and chemicals.

    high pressure homogenizers work by forcing a liquid product through a narrow gap at high speeds, resulting in intense turbulence and shearing forces that break down particles and droplets into smaller sizes. This process helps to achieve emulsions, dispersions, and suspensions with a stable and uniform distribution of particles, leading to improved product quality, shelf life, and overall customer satisfaction.

    One of the key benefits of high pressure homogenizers is their ability to create stable emulsions by reducing the droplet size of oil or fat in water or vice versa. This is especially important in industries such as dairy, where homogenization is essential for producing products like milk, cream, and yogurt with a smooth and creamy texture. By using high pressure to break down fat globules into smaller sizes, homogenizers prevent creaming, improve mouthfeel, and enhance the sensory experience of the final product.

    Another advantage of high pressure homogenizers is their ability to achieve uniform particle size distribution in suspensions and dispersions. In industries such as pharmaceuticals and cosmetics, homogenization is crucial for ensuring the consistency and efficacy of products like creams, lotions, and ointments. By reducing particle size and achieving a uniform distribution, homogenizers help to improve product stability, absorption, and performance, ultimately leading to higher customer satisfaction and brand loyalty.

    high pressure homogenizers are also widely used in the chemical industry for processes such as particle size reduction, nanoemulsions, and cell disruption. By utilizing high pressure and shear forces, homogenizers can effectively break down solid particles, create stable emulsions, and disrupt cell membranes, leading to improved product quality, efficiency, and yields. These capabilities make homogenizers an essential tool for industries that rely on precise particle size control and consistent product quality.

    In addition to their technical capabilities, high pressure homogenizers also offer several operational benefits for manufacturers. These machines are designed for continuous operation, allowing for high throughput and efficiency in processing large volumes of product. They are also versatile and easy to adjust, making it possible to customize processing parameters such as pressure, temperature, and flow rate to meet specific product requirements. Furthermore, high pressure homogenizers are built to withstand harsh operating conditions, ensuring long-term reliability and performance in demanding production environments.

  • The Importance Of NSCS Cyber Essentials For Secure Online Practices

    In today’s digital age, cybersecurity has become more important than ever With the rise of cyber threats and attacks, organizations and individuals need to prioritize their online security The National Cyber Security Centre (NCSC) in the UK has developed a set of guidelines and best practices called NSCS Cyber Essentials to help protect against common cyber threats.

    NSCS Cyber Essentials is a government-backed cybersecurity certification scheme that helps organizations guard against the most common cyber threats and demonstrate their commitment to cybersecurity By implementing the five fundamental cybersecurity controls outlined in the scheme, organizations can minimize their risk of falling victim to cyber attacks.

    The five key controls of NSCS Cyber Essentials include:

    1 Secure configuration – Ensuring that systems are securely configured to reduce the risk of unauthorized access and exploitation.

    2 Boundary firewalls and internet gateways – Implementing firewalls and gateways to protect networks from external threats and malicious activities.

    3 Access control and administrative privilege management – Monitoring and controlling access to systems and data to prevent unauthorized access.

    4 Patch management – Keeping software up to date with the latest security patches to address known vulnerabilities and reduce the risk of exploitation.

    5 Anti-malware protection – Using anti-malware software to detect and remove malicious software that could compromise systems and data.

    By implementing these controls, organizations can enhance their cybersecurity posture and protect their critical assets from cyber threats Achieving NSCS Cyber Essentials certification not only improves security but also demonstrates a commitment to cybersecurity to customers, partners, and stakeholders.
